Seven houseboats gutted in fire at Nigeen Lake

Photo-Javed Khan/Kashmir Images

F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

Srinagar: A fire at the Nigeen Lake here in the early hours of Monday destroyed seven houseboats, officials said.

The fire broke out on one of the houseboats anchored at the rear side of Nigeen Club on the lake and quickly spread to adjacent houseboats, resulting in destruction of seven of the floating hotels besides three sheds.

“We noticed fire in a houseboat at around 2:00 am and instantly informed the fire and emergency service. However, the intense blaze had destroyed six other houseboats before the firefighters could reach the spot,” Javaid Ahmad, a local told ‘Kashmir Images’

The cause of fire, which destroyed property worth crores of rupees, was not immediately known.

An official from fire and emergency service said six fire tenders were rushed to the spot instantly after receiving information about the fire incident. He said seven deluxe houseboats were completely gutted and property worth crores destroyed in the incident.

The names of houseboats damaged in the inferno are India Palace, New Maharaja Palace, Lily of The World, Flora, Young Swift, Jersey and Royal Paradise.

Meanwhile, National conference president Dr Farooq Abdullah expressed anguish over fire incident and asked the divisional administration to reach out to affected with relief and compensation.
